Why Every Neighborhood Wants a Primary Medical Care Center
Access to reliable healthcare is a fundamental necessity for every community. While hospitals and specialized clinics play an important function in advanced treatment, the foundation of a healthy neighborhood lies in having a primary medical care center nearby. These centers are sometimes the primary point of contact for patients, providing essential services that transcend fundamental check-ups. Their presence can transform the overall well-being of a community, reduce healthcare costs, and be certain that people receive timely care.
Accessibility and Comfort
Some of the compelling reasons every neighborhood wants a primary medical care center is accessibility. When medical services are close to home, persons are more likely to seek care early quite than waiting till health problems turn into serious. For households, this comfort means less journey time and easier access for children, elderly kin, or individuals with limited mobility. By removing boundaries comparable to long commutes or costly transportation, primary care centers make healthcare more inclusive and available to everybody in the neighborhood.
Preventive Care and Early Detection
Primary care providers aren't only targeted on treating illnesses but in addition on stopping them. Routine screenings, vaccinations, and common check-ups assist establish potential health issues earlier than they turn out to be major problems. Early detection of conditions like diabetes, hypertension, or heart illness greatly improves patient outcomes and lowers the risk of costly emergency interventions later. A neighborhood medical care center acts as a proactive guardian of public health, making certain residents stay ahead of stopable diseases.
Building Long-Term Doctor-Patient Relationships
Unlike emergency rooms or specialised clinics where patients might even see totally different doctors every visit, primary care centers encourage long-term relationships between patients and providers. Over time, doctors gain a complete understanding of their patients’ medical hitales, lifestyles, and risk factors. This personalized approach allows for more accurate diagnoses and treatment plans. The trust built between community members and healthcare professionals also improves patient satisfaction and adherence to medical advice.
Reducing Strain on Emergency Services
Emergency rooms are sometimes overcrowded, with many patients seeking treatment for conditions that could have been addressed at a primary medical care center. By providing fast attention for non-emergency points equivalent to infections, minor injuries, or chronic disease management, neighborhood medical centers assist reduce unnecessary hospital visits. This permits emergency departments to give attention to critical cases, while residents obtain quicker, more cost-efficient treatment close to home.
Supporting Families and Vulnerable Populations
A local primary medical care center turns into a cornerstone for families. Parents can deliver children in for routine vaccinations, school physicals, and general wellness checks, while seniors can access chronic disease management and medicine monitoring. Vulnerable groups such as low-revenue families benefit from affordable care options which may not be accessible through private clinics or distant hospitals. In lots of neighborhoods, these centers also provide mental health services, counseling, and assist programs, making a holistic healthcare environment.
Boosting Community Health and Safety
Healthy communities are strong communities. When residents have access to common medical care, there is a decrease within the spread of communicable ailments, fewer untreated chronic conditions, and a stronger emphasis on healthy lifestyles. Local primary care centers usually arrange health training programs, nutrition workshops, and fitness initiatives to encourage preventive living. This community-based approach builds a tradition of health awareness, improving the quality of life for everyone within the area.
Cost-Effective Healthcare
Healthcare costs are a major concern for individuals and families. Primary medical care centers provide affordable services that assist forestall costly hospital stays and advanced treatments. By catching health issues early, managing chronic conditions, and promoting preventive care, these centers lower general medical expenses for residents. On a bigger scale, neighborhoods with accessible primary care services contribute to reduced healthcare costs for complete cities and states.
Strengthening Neighborhood Resilience
In occasions of disaster, whether or not it’s a pandemic, natural catastrophe, or public health emergency, having a primary medical care center within the neighborhood strengthens resilience. Local clinics can quickly mobilize resources, provide vaccinations, distribute drugs, and serve as information hubs for residents. Their presence ensures that communities stay supported even when larger healthcare systems are overwhelmed.
Each neighborhood deserves the security and help of a primary medical care center. These facilities do more than treat illness—they foster long-term health, improve accessibility, reduce emergency burdens, and create stronger, safer communities. By investing in local primary care, neighborhoods be sure that each resident, regardless of age or background, has access to well timed, affordable, and reliable healthcare.
